
Lakeland rebounds with 19-6 win over Angola
(LAGRANGE) – The Lakeland football team bounced back from a loss to Garrett by beating visiting Angola 19-6 in an NECC Big School Division contest at the newly renamed Miller Field, despite 4 turnovers on the night. Brayden Holbrook was 13 of 24 for 89 yards and a touchdown and two interceptions. He also rushed 11 times for 21 yards and another score and a fumble. Carson Mickem had 8 carries for 39 yards with a touchdown and a fumble. Levi Cook had 3 receptions for 35 yards and a score. Keyan Arroyo led the Laker defense with 7 tackles. Mickem had 5 tackles while Drannon Miller, Isaiah Weingartner each Cruz Richard each had 4 tackles. Lakeland is now 4-1 overall and 1-1 in the NECC Big School Division. Angola falls to 1-4 and 0-2 in the division.
